Actually, I open Network every time I go on line (eg, it's open right now); I can connect from that panel and monitor time online as well as whether stuff is loading. And Modem is indeed my top item.

Clearing those caches still seems to have done the trick.
In fact, earlier today I showed a colleague with a new MacBook Pro running Lion how to do that, and it likewise cleared up a whole bunch of problems he was experiencing in Word and Mail.

I'm happy, although still mystified, that clearing those caches has apparently turned all the tricks that needed turning, but just remember that trashing entire cache folders willy-nilly has the potential to cost you data and/or settings that not only most likely have nothing to do with your issue but may be a major nuisance to recreate.
